Slide out roof panel
The 12" passenger side slide-out roof panel in my 06 Itasca Horizon needs to be replaced and I'm struggling with who does the repair. WBGO factory is 14 hour drive one way and I'll need to leave it for 8 days. Thats two round trips to Forrest City in less than 2 weeks. Their price seems reasonable and much less than any of the local shops I've checked with so far. Or, should I let a local shop do the work. I don't know how complex of a job it is and I don't know much about the competency of my local shops so that's why I've been leaning toward letting WBGO do the work. Am I making this too difficult? Is this a job any shop should be able to do? Your thoughts and recommendation would be appreciated.

Well if it were me I think I would take it to the factory. I doubt any local shop could do as good a job as the boys from Forest City.
A round trip flight from Des Moines to Birmingham is right at $315. The Factory is about 2 hrs from Des Moines. A rental car is under $40. Motorhome fuel will cost about $800 round trip.
Obviously a tough call but if the factory repair estimate is $1200 cheaper than local then the math works out in favor of driving up to Forest City.
